Several factors can affect the consistency of breast milk, such as the mother's diet, hydration levels, and overall health. The consistency of breast milk can impact the nutritional value for infants by affecting the amount of fat, protein, and other nutrients present in the milk. Inconsistent milk composition may lead to variations in the infant's intake of essential nutrients, potentially impacting their growth and development.

To determine the number of moles of aluminum present in 856g, you need to divide the mass by the molar mass of aluminum. The molar mass of aluminum is approximately 26.98 g/mol. So, 856g ÷ 26.98 g/mol ≈ 31.7 moles of aluminum are present in 856g.
